Almansa has a population of approximately 24,000 people. The majority of the population is of Spanish descent, though in recent years, the city has seen modest growth in immigrant populations, particularly from Latin America and Eastern Europe. This has added a layer of diversity to the local community, while traditional Castilian customs remain dominant in daily life.
The population is relatively balanced across age groups, with a mix of young families, working professionals, and retirees. The city has a warm, welcoming atmosphere, with strong community ties and a focus on preserving local traditions.
